[QUOTE="zumbly, post: 3116694, member: 57495"]On the topic of dots, it's known that for Claudius II, Smyrna and Cyzicus used dots below the bust as officina marks. Coin #2 has two dots and was an unrecorded issue in the original RIC - I won't expect $1000 for it, but perhaps that fact could garner it a few more votes in the poll? :angelic: In all honesty, I'm actually heartened to see it got as many votes as it did. More surprising to me is the number of votes Coin #4 with the crazy double strike has received. As of now it leads the pack as favorite, albeit with Coin #3 a very close second. Coin #4 is personally my favorite as well, with the other three about equal. Go, Kevin! :D Thanks to everyone for voting and giving your thoughts, I think it's been an interesting and fun little exercise. Poll results as of now : Coin #1: Rome mint / Annona reverse. Published in The Celator vol. 16, no 10 (Oct 2002). - [B]5 votes[/B] Coin #2:[B] [/B]Smyrna mint / Mercury reverse. Extremely Rare, one of two known specimens. - [B]7 votes[/B] Coin #3:[B] [/B]Rome mint / Pax reverse. High grade...for a Claudius II. - [B]17 votes[/B] Coin #4:[B] [/B]Siscia mint / Pax reverse. Dramatic obverse double strike. Kevin's choice. - [B]18 votes[/B][/QUOTE]
